How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outer Mesquite?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outer Mesquite Studio Apartments | $1,054 | $556 | $1,762 |
Outer Mesquite 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,284 | $590 | $4,134 |
| Outer Mesquite 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,651 | $696 | $6,279 |
| Outer Mesquite 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,239 | $819 | $9,255 |
| Outer Mesquite 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,337 | $1,824 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Outer Mesquite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Outer Mesquite with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Outer Mesquite is at Iron Landings listed at $699.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Outer Mesquite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Outer Mesquite is $1,284.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Outer Mesquite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Outer Mesquite is a 1,170 square feet unit starting from $3,160 at Modera Trailhead.
What is the average size for Outer Mesquite 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Outer Mesquite is currently 692 sq ft.
